What is a 2009 Impala Wiring Diagram and How is it Used?

A 2009 Impala wiring diagram is essentially a visual representation of all the electrical circuits within your vehicle. It details the pathways of electricity, showing how components like the battery, alternator, lights, radio, engine control module, and countless other systems are interconnected. These diagrams are not just simple lines; they use specific symbols to represent different electrical parts and the type of connection. These diagrams serve a multitude of purposes. For DIY enthusiasts, they are invaluable for identifying the correct wires for a specific circuit, checking for continuity, or tracing a fault. Professional mechanics rely heavily on them to diagnose complex electrical problems efficiently. Here's a breakdown of what you'll typically find within a 2009 Impala wiring diagram:
  • Component Identification: Each major electrical component is clearly labeled with its name and often a reference number.
  • Wire Colors and Gauges: The diagram will indicate the color of each wire, which is vital for quick identification. It may also show the wire gauge (thickness), which is important for current-carrying capacity.
  • Connectors and Terminals: Details about where wires connect, including specific connector types and pin assignments, are provided.
  • Circuit Protection: Fuses and relays, which protect the electrical system from overloads, are prominently displayed with their ratings.
To illustrate, consider a common scenario: a headlight not working. A 2009 Impala wiring diagram would allow you to trace the power supply from the battery, through the fuse and relay, to the headlight switch, and finally to the headlight bulb itself. This step-by-step visual guide helps pinpoint exactly where the break in the circuit might be.
  1. Locate the specific circuit for the malfunctioning component (e.g., left headlight).
  2. Identify the power source (e.g., battery terminal).
  3. Follow the wire path, noting any fuses, relays, switches, or ground connections.
  4. Check continuity at various points along the circuit using a multimeter.
